It looks like you have a nicely designed site. One recommendation I would make to get the most out of it is to SEO the site. I ran a quick scan and the two most popular words on your homepage are the bullet point symbol and the word "asking" instead of the keywords you are going for.

The only problem I see for your keywords is that they are very general - everyone in your field is using them. I know that when you install php engines, they come with the keywords preset. I suggest you think about how to make them more individual to your site... i.e. find a niche market.

Yes, the middot is the bullet symbol I refered to earlier which has many repetitions.

Also the first two words of the homepage title tag are "Free Classifieds" but the homepage has very low density of the word "free".

I usually check keyword density one page at a time, rather than the global approach, but both approaches will give good information regarding the SEO needs of a site.
